Stainless screws, which are not coated, will not discolor cedar. Screws used with composite decking typically have a much smaller head and tighter threads. The smaller head reduces composite tear-out. In some cases, these screws have a reverse-thread just under the screw head.
A reverse thread ensures the screw sits cleanly at level with the composite deck board. Composite screws, with their narrow thread, also have the benefit of not needing any pre-drilling. This is a huge time saver.
All composite fasteners come with a weatherproof coating and a star or torx head. Lag bolts are a tried and tested method to affix two pieces of lumber in shear force applications. However, unlike a typical bolt, a lag bolt has a pointed end like a screw. Lag bolts are ideal for posts or ledger boards, where the construction of the deck requires the bolt to be buried in the lumber.
The prime focus of your deck, you want your deck boards to be secure and to look good. For most of us, working within a strict budget, coated deck screws are the most viable option. Standard green or brown coated screws are the cheapest. A 8 diameter deck screw is ideal, as any higher would split the wood. Remember, if you are using cedar, then you should opt to use a hidden fastening system as these coated screws will stain your cedar.
If you prefer a cleaner look for your deck boards, then the CAMO fasteners are ideal. Unlike other hidden systems that use brackets between the deck boards, the CAMO system relies on a handheld jig that fits over the width of a deck board. On either end, the jig has two angled holes that ensure the screw is fastened diagonally, out of sight. These screws are also coated but are narrower at 7 diameter.
Each pack of screws comes with a bit, which is star-shaped. As well, the screws have a reverse-thread near the head. This pulls any wood that has torn out during the screw back in, reducing any tearout. Remember that a bucket of CAMO deck screws is about double the amount of regular deck fasteners, not to mention the cost of the jig.

Finish: Consider the weather at your building site. Stainless steel screws are ideal for places with heavier exposure to precipitation and temperature shifts. Tip: If you're building a cedar or redwood deck or using any type of wood with high acidic content , your best bet is to go with stainless steel to avoid black streaks on your wood.

Vise-Grip pliers are the tool of choice for removing broken decking screws. Clamp the pliers on the head or what is left of the deck screw on the surface and twist the screw out.
If the deck screw breaks below the surface, drill a slightly angled hole adjacent to the broken deck screw. Wax a new deck screw and slowly and carefully install it next to the broken deck screw. For a clean, unencumbered deck surface on a wood framed deck, many of our clients prefer a hidden deck fastener.
To achieve this look, the Mataverde Eurotec Hidden Deck Fastener is a great hidden fastening option for decking. Both are coated black for low visibility. The extra-long clip is ideal for aligning the decking, especially where the butt ends of two decking boards meet. Rather than drilling and screwing through the face of the deck boards, the hidden fasteners are drilled and screwed on a 45 degree angle though the deck boards into the deck joists.

Want to see the best hidden deck fastener available? This patented deck screw has a drill point, a coarse lower thread, a smooth upper shank and a countersink head. The drill point eliminates the need for pre-drilling your deck boards. The coarse thread drives the screw home. The smooth upper shank ejects the drilling waste.
